I worked for over 7 years in the software outsourcing business. I have over 5 years of experience in the field of project management, software architecture and team leadership. Companies from all over Europe are listed among my end clients and I can mention here businesses from United Kingdom, Israel, and Turkey. I have over ten thousand hours spent in concrete software development activities, as well as more than five thousand hours spent in project architecture, planning and management.
My projects range from web based applications to desktop apps, windows services and Android applications.
· .Net: C#, ASP .NET
· Java
· Java for Android
· PHP
· SQL (the ANSI92 standard)
· Flash
· Flex
· Javascript
· ADO.NET
· ODBC
· XML
· HTML, HTML 5
· CSS 1/2/3
· jQuery, jQueryUI
· Leaflet
· Three JS
· MSSQL
· MySQL
· MongoDB
· Adobe Photoshop
· Adobe Illustrator
· Adobe InDesign
· Adobe AfterEffects
· Adobe Director
· 3D Studio Max
· Camtasia Studio TechSmith
· Interactive design
· Interactive mockups and prototypes
· Paper and digital prototyping
Some of the companies I worked for across the years
· I together with my team developed their in-house platform for hotel booking. Created a full suite of software dedicated to event coordination from initial planning to on-site solutions and after event feedbacks. From web applications in the cloud to manage the event program prior of the start date to flash/air/flex and html applications during the event to showcase the data for specific uses the solutions we developed were aimed to the whole lifecycle of an event.
· Created several e-Books for various end clients. Each e-Book was unique and offered full text search capability, sharing to social media platforms, bookmark support, media support (video/flash/sound), *** protection, automatic QR-code creation
· Created SMS voting platform where votes were sent via SMS and results were displayed real-time in a web application.
· Created a badge management solution that allows customizing templates per each installation, printing of badges and keeping count of how many were printed/scanned for the final usage report. It also allowed a mailshot to be sent to all future visitors with their badge details.
· Created a photo booth software with Flickr backend for storing images.
· Created various Android applications for corporate presentations
· Created a suite of software for e-booths management. Each e-booths can upload its’ own design, product brochures, presentation videos. Having access to unique url the e-booths can be placed as an email signature or website presence. For specific installations a floorplan with all the e-booths can be displayed and the website visitor has the ability to search for an e-booth or company name.
· We developed various software tools for their in-house use, maintenance of one of their products, migrating one of their products from ASP to ASP.NET, analysis and development of new features and enhancements for the new products.
· We developed the administrative console for the company product, project managed the old product and assisted the project manager for the new flex version of the product.
· Developing a platform for congresses management. Includes presentation modules for web, mobile web (IPhone, Android and BlackBerry), native apps and interfaces with flash applications for congress on-site data display.
· Managed a team of 7+ people that developed and maintained congress platform solutions. Includes managing day to day operations, writing specifications for the new modules to be implemented, evaluation of different solutions to be used in our platform, etc.
· Developed 3D games with Adobe Director/DirectX for external clients and also created the 3D models/assets used.
· Created various flash games with theme requested by final client. This includes either new games or copies of existing games.
· E-learning modules were created to be used in the final clients’ software. They were mostly done in Flash technology
· Created 3D simulations for rooms, buildings, etc. based on the specific client requirements to be further used in architecture (interior design or project display)
· E-Voting solutions based on badges. Each badge had 2 sides: one for Yes one for No and upon scanning the badge we would record the vote and check the validity of the person. On the admin side several questions could be entered and reports generated (from presence of e-voters to the voting results).